Output 3d7c9aeba11b4635467671a630bd62c595a75ded6145d4598967b8d2db798718:0

value
707676
script pubkey
OP_0 OP_PUSHBYTES_20 ed5fd3e40ba362bbcbe53319be3fabcc76542de8
address
bc1qa40a8eqt5d3thjl9xvvmu0ate3m9gt0g03tz3k
transaction
3d7c9aeba11b4635467671a630bd62c595a75ded6145d4598967b8d2db798718
confirmations
171442
spent
true